5 - 7
5 I/O Refreshing Methods
NX-series Position Interface Units User’s Manual (W524)
5-2 I/O Refreshing Methods
5
5-2-3 I/O Refreshing Method Operation
The NX Units that use synchronous I/O refreshing in an EtherCAT Slave Terminal receive inputs at a
set fixed interval based on the synchronization timing. Outputs are also refreshed simultaneously, but at
a separately set timing from inputs.
Refer to the NX-series EtherCAT Coupler Unit User’s Manual (Cat. No. W519-E1-05 or later) for infor-
mation on the Slave Terminals that operate with the same timing when more than one Slave Terminal is
placed on the same EtherCAT network.
The refresh cycle of the NX bus is automatically calculated by the Sysmac Studio based on the I/O
refresh cycles of the NX Units when the Slave Terminal configuration is set.
If an EtherCAT Slave Terminal is connected to the built-in EtherCAT port on an NX-series CPU Unit, the
NX bus refresh cycle is automatically calculated by the Sysmac Studio for each periodic task. They are
calculated for the primary periodic task and priority-5 periodic task.
For the built-in EtherCAT port on an NJ-series CPU Units, they are calculated for the primary periodic
task.
Precautions for Correct Use
• The NX bus refresh cycle is automatically set to agree with the task period of the primary
period task or priority-5 periodic task, but the task period is not set automatically. Set the task
period to a value that is greater than the refresh cycle of the NX bus that is calculated by the
Sysmac Studio.
Refer to the NX-series EtherCAT Coupler Unit User’s Manual (Cat. No. W519-E1-05 or later)
for information on setting the task periods of periodic tasks.
• The EtherCAT Slave Terminals with enabled distributed clocks and all EtherCAT slaves that
support DC synchronization execute I/O processing based on Sync0, which is shared on the
EtherCAT network. However, because the specifications and performance for the timing to
read inputs or to refresh outputs for EtherCAT slaves and NX Units are different, the timing to
read inputs or to refresh outputs is not simultaneous between the EtherCAT slaves and the
NX Units.
Refer to the manuals for the EtherCAT slaves for information on the timing to read inputs or
to refresh outputs in EtherCAT slaves.
Operation of Synchronous I/O Refreshing